Separate and Combined Effects of Fusarium oxysporum f. sp. tracheiphilum and Meloidogyne incognita on Growth and Yield of Cowpea (Vigna unguiculata L. Walp) Var. Moussa-Local

摘要

A study was undertaken to determine the separate and combined affects of Fusarium oxysporum f sp. tracheiphilum and Meloidogyne incognita on growth and yield of cowpea variety Moussa-local. It was observed that growth and yield components of the cowpea were generally reduced in all treatments as compared to that of control. Single infection with only nematode caused more growth and yield reductions than infection with only fungus. Reduction in the growth and yield components were generally higher insimultaneous infection than infection with either of the pathogens. Growth and yield reduction in combined infection did not vary significantly from those caused by successive infection where either of the pathogens was made to precede the other. Infection with both pathogens caused significant increases in the root galls, mmiber of eggs and juveniles when compared with infection with nematode only.
